:root {
    color-scheme: dark;
    --fg0: white;
    --fg1: violet;
    --bg0: #282a36;
    --bg1: #44475a;
}

body {
    background-color: var(--bg0);
    display: grid;
    font-family: "Noto Sans";
    place-items: center;
    place-self: center;
}

.container {
    background-color: var(--bg1);
    border-color: var(--bg1);
    border-radius: 1rem;
    border-style: solid;
    border-width: 0.5rem;
    font-size: large;
    margin: 1rem;
    max-width: 64rem;
}

.title {
    padding: 0 0 0.5rem 0;
    font-size: x-large;
}

.title a {
    color: var(--fg0);
}

.ico {
    height: 2rem;
    vertical-align: bottom;
    width: 2rem;
}

.content {
    background-color: var(--bg0);
    border-radius: 0.5rem;
    padding: 0.5rem; 
}

a {
    color: var(--fg1);
    text-decoration: none;
}

code {
    background-color: var(--bg1);
    border-radius: 0.5rem;
    padding: 0.25rem;
    user-select: all;
}
